DOM(元素节点)本文介绍了元素节点的基本操作:增删改查增新增一个元素节点分为两步(二者缺一不可),第一步:创建元素节点,第二步:将创建的元素节点插入到指定元素节点中(也就是插入指定元素节点的儿子元素节点)<divid="box">原本存在的</div><scripttype="text/javascript">varexDiv=document.querySelector("#box");...
DOM——基本组成与操作DOM是针对HTML和XML文档的一个API(应用程序编程接口)。DOM描绘了一个层次化的节点树,允许开发人员添加、移除和修改页面的某一部分。他给文档提供了一种结构化的表达方式,可以改变文档的内容和呈现方式,我们最关心的是,DOM把网页和脚本以及其他的编程语言联系了起来。所谓的DOM是以家族的形式描述HTML(父子节点和兄弟节点),那么,什么是DOM呢?我们可以从这几点解析...
DOM(属性节点)属性节点没有过参加家族关系中,其专用选择器:attributes,返回值为对象的形式,它的键是索引值,也就是用对象模拟了一个伪数组,DOM中选择器返回的都是伪数组(可以使用数组的形式遍历,操作。但是不能使用数组的方法),下面是属性节点的操作<divclass="box"title="这是一个title"width="400"></div><scripttype="text/...
一、jquery对象的基本方法:(1)get();取得所有匹配的元素(2)get(index);取得其中一个匹配的元素$(this).get(0)等同于$(this)[0](3)Numberindex(jqueryObj);搜索子对象(4)each(callback);类似foreach,不过遍历的是元素数组如:$("img".each(function(index){...
起因今天写页面的时候突然有这么个需求,由于父元素(一个DIV)的height是由javascript计算出来的固定的值,而在其中增加了一个多说插件,在用户评论后,子元素(DIV)的height属性增加,导致子元素溢出。但是又不知道如何为多说的评论按钮增加回调函数,于是乎就想到了根据子元素的大小变化来重新计算父元素的height。onresize?平常,都是在整个浏览器窗口变化时触发一个修改布局的回...
jQuery对象与DOM对象的区别1.DOM对象:使用JavaScript中的方法获取页面中的元素返回的对象就是dom对象。2.jQuery对象:jquery对象就是使用jquery的方法获取页面中的元素返回的对象就是jQuery对象。3.jQuery对象其实就是DOM对象的包装集(包装了DOM对象的集合(伪数组))4.DOM对象与jQuery对象的方法不能混用。5.联系:...
此文章是由jquery学堂java群里面的网友【火星-小鬼】分享在群共享的,觉得对网友们的学习有帮忙就把它整理发布到JquerySchool网站上了,希望可以帮到大家,好好利用哦。。。XML现在已经成为一种通用的数据交换格式,它的平台无关性,语言无关性,系统无关性,给数据集成与交互带来了极大的方便。对于XML本身的语法知识与技术细节,需要阅读相关的技术文献,这里面包括的内容有DOM(Documen...
Dom元素基本操作方法API,先记录下,方便以后使用。W3CDOM和JavaScript很容易混淆不清。DOM是面向HTML和XML文档的API,为文档提供了结构化表示,并定义了如何通过脚本来访问文档结构。JavaScript则是用于访问和处理DOM的语言。如果没有DOM,JavaScript根本没有Web页面和构成页面元素的概念。文档中的每个元素都是DOM的一部分,这就使得JavaScr...
1、访问节点document.getElementById(id);返回对拥有指定id的第一个对象进行访问document.getElementsByName(name);返回带有指定名称的节点集合注意:Elementsdocument.getElementsByTagName(tagname);返回带有指定标签名的对象集合注意:Elementsdocument.getElementsByCla...
二:DOM操作属性我们以<imgid="a"scr="5.jpg"/>为例,在原始的javascript里面可以用varo=document.getElementById('a')取的id为a的节点对象,在用o.src来取得或修改该节点的scr属性,在jQuery里$("#a")将得到Jquery对象[<imgid="a"scr="5.jpg"/>],然后可以用jQuery提供的...